The procedure of paintless dent repair work involves specialized devices and strategies to carefully massage the metal back to its initial type. Extremely knowledgeable professionals access the dent from behind the panel, utilizing numerous tools to push and pull the damaged area. This approach is specifically efficient for shallow dents brought on by hail storm, door dings, or minor crashes. One of the key variables that establish the success of PDR is the kind of product and location of the damage, making the expertise of the professional vital to the fixing procedure.
One of the key advantages of PDR is that it is an eco-friendly option. Considering that this technique does not call for any type of fillers, paint, or chemicals, it reduces waste and minimizes the carbon footprint connected with standard repair work methods. Additionally, PDR is usually quicker than standard damage repair services, often enabling clients to have their lorries returned on the exact same day. This not just conserves time yet additionally makes sure that the vehicle keeps even more of its value, as the original paint remains intact.
While paintless damage repair is an excellent choice for numerous types of damages, it is not appropriate for every single circumstance. Deep folds, extensive damage, or dents found on edges or joints might still call for traditional repair service techniques that involve repainting and bodywork. Automobile proprietors should seek advice from skilled PDR service technicians to examine the damages and determine the very best strategy for their details requirements.
